Output 85b63fc37e44242e2bb06beff6ddd4c5be8e91f7e093402c2508d0e8d89578c4:10

value
405189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66121a263f34c6399137812f64db83cfd78119ba OP_EQUAL
address
3AziXsPeWhtXTA86xhep4ZrcVgbD8tjasb
transaction
85b63fc37e44242e2bb06beff6ddd4c5be8e91f7e093402c2508d0e8d89578c4
confirmations
159628
spent
true